The sad truth is that the healthcare

dollars spent in the US do

not equate to better health. Our

country is in trouble because

diabetes is on the rise and the

rate of overweight adults is well

over 50% of the population.

Did you know that you can save

$2000 per year by maintaining a

healthy body weight? You can

also avoid a much higher risk for

heart disease, diabetes and many

cancers.

If you can avoid getting diabetes

you can save almost $6000 per

year!

Actually, a sustained 10% weight

loss will reduce an overweight

person’s lifetime medical costs

by $2,200-$5,300.
